Compostela Valley farmer activist killed in attack

DAVAO CITY—A farmer activist was killed while her husband, daughter and two grandchildren were in critical condition after armed men attacked them in Compostela Valley on Thursday evening.
Carolina Arado succumbed from gunshot wounds while the rest of her family were immediately brought to a hospital for medical treatment.
The family was inside their house in Barangay Anitapan in the town of Mabini when armed men attacked them at around 6:40 p.m., said Christoper Alia of the Hugpong sa Maguuma sa Mabini (Humabin).
Alia said the Arados were active members of Humabin, a progressive farmers’ group that strongly opposed the entry of large-scale mining operations in the province.
The couple also joined campaigns against alleged abuses of government forces in the area./rga
